About NOBA Bank Nordax is a Swedish bank that since its founding in 2003 has grown to have more than 300,000 customers across four different markets. Nordax Bank is a company with fast decision-making processes and high pace on its way to becoming Northern Europe's leading specialist bank. Nordax Bank is currently owned by Nordic Capital Fund VIII/IX and Sampo. Since January 2019, Svensk Hypotekspension has been a wholly owned subsidiary of Nordax Bank, and in 2021 they also acquired Bank Norwegian and operate together as NOBA Bank Group. At the headquarters in Stockholm, approximately 450 employees work together on the bank's guiding star and core competence – responsible lending. The Swedish National Heritage Board is a government agency that conducts museum activities and contract archaeology. Our shared vision is "Together we make history meaningful for more". The museums are the Museum of Economics with Tumba Bruksmuseum, the Hallwyl Collection, the Swedish History Museum, the Royal Armoury, Drottningholm Palace, and the Swedish Holocaust Museum. The contract activities Archaeologists has offices in five regions. Our task is to promote knowledge of and interest in Swedish history and to preserve and develop the cultural heritage managed by the agency. The agency has approximately 400 employees.
